Output d3025461ff569143c475ffb648bdaf2a85a987875f1cd9f53ac71de7b6a1d4e1:0

value
65000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b8b2b85eeddadb1dbd82aacf2d4452e5471fb22 OP_EQUAL
address
3BVewmhtWb8uhWqaFMSFWHrH3KYYNobZDU
transaction
d3025461ff569143c475ffb648bdaf2a85a987875f1cd9f53ac71de7b6a1d4e1
confirmations
260029
spent
true